NCT ID: NCT05706454 Recruiting - COVID-19 Pneumonia Clinical Trials

Phase 2/Phase 3 Study To Evaluate The Efficacy And Safety Of Ramatroban Along With The Standard Of Care In Subjects Hospitalized For COVID Pneumonia

Start date: November 10, 2022
Phase: Phase 2/Phase 3
Study type: Interventional

Phase II/Phase III study to evaluate the safety and efficacy of Ramatroban 75 mg tablet against Placebo in subjects hospitalized for pneumonia due to SARS-CoV-2 infection. Approximately 324 eligible subjects will be randomized in a 1:1 ratio to one of the two treatment groups. Group I: Ramatroban 75 mg tablet + Standard of care; Group II: Placebo + Standard of care. Phase 2 Primary Objective: To evaluate the safety of Ramatroban 75 mg tablet with the standard of care against Placebo with the standard of care in COVID-19 hospitalized subjects. Secondary Objective: To assess the efficacy of Ramatroban 75 mg tablet with the standard of care against Placebo with the standard of care in COVID-19 hospitalized subjects. Phase 3 Primary Objective: To evaluate the efficacy of Ramatroban 75 mg tablet with the standard of care against Placebo with the standard of care in COVID-19 hospitalized subjects. Secondary Objective: To evaluate the safety of Ramatroban 75 mg tablet with the standard of care against Placebo with the standard of care in COVID-19 hospitalized subjects. Long COVID [Follow-up Phase- Objectives- (Phase 2 & 3)] 1. To examine lipid mediators, specifically thromboxane A2, prostaglandin D2, F2-isoprostane and/or their metabolites in convalescent subjects after treatment. 2. To assess the efficacy of Ramatroban administered during the acute illness in preventing/mitigating subsequent development of long COVID / PASC

NCT ID: NCT05690516 Completed - COVID-19 Clinical Trials

The Protective Effect of Mask Wearing Against Respiratory Tract Infections

Start date: February 10, 2023
Phase: N/A
Study type: Interventional

In this trial the researchers plan to recruit 4,000 volunteers to be randomly allocated either wearing face masks in public spaces where they are close to other people, or not wear face masks in such circumstances. For each participant the trial period is 2 weeks, after which they will be asked to complete a brief questionnaire which includes questions about whether they experienced the common cold, influenzas or COVID-19 symptoms during the trail period.

NCT ID: NCT05685953 Completed - Clinical trials for COVID-19 Respiratory Infection

A Randomized, Phase I Study of DNA Vaccine OC-007 as a Booster Dose of COVID-19 Vaccine

OpenCorona1
Start date: February 8, 2023
Phase: Phase 1
Study type: Interventional

This is a randomized, placebo-controlled, double-blinded phase I study, designed to evaluate the safety including reactogenicity and immunogenicity of this investigational DNA vaccine delivered intramuscularly by in vivo EP in human adults. The vaccine doses will be given to healthy adults aged 18 to 60 years, who have been previously vaccinated against COVID-19 with 3 doses of either Comirnaty® or Spikevax®, or both in any combination ≥3 months ago.

NCT ID: NCT05670678 Completed - Clinical trials for Respiratory Infection

Improved Respiratory Infection by Consuming Lactoferrin Fortified a2 Growing up Formula in Children of 2 to 3 Year Old

Start date: December 19, 2022
Phase:
Study type: Observational

The goal of this observational study is to compare the incidence of ARI and/or diarrheal disease associated with feeding different formulas with and without lactoferrin supplement in children of 2-3 years old. 200 children eligible for the study will be enrolled from two study sites and randomly assigned to two groups (a2 growing up stage 3 formula puls lactoferrin supplement, and Enfinitas growing up stage 3 formula) to feed for 90 days. About 160 children (80 for each group) are expected to finish the study, and data will be collected during the four visits across the study. Researchers will compare the two groups to see if there is significant decrease of the occurrence of diarrheal disease and/or acute respiratory infection for children fed with a2 growing up stage 3 formula puls lactoferrin supplement
